Smart dimming glass is a new type of special optoelectronic glass that is formed by mixing a liquid crystal film between two layers of glass and bonding them under high temperature. and high pressure.
By implementation mode, it falls into electric controlled, temperature controlled, optical controlled and pressure controlled.
In the automotive field, there are four major types of dimming glass: polymer dispersed liquid crystal (PDLC), suspended particle devices (SPD), electrochromic (EC) and dye liquid crystal (Dye LC). Wherein, PDLC, SPD and Dye LC have physical dimming, and EC chemical dimming.
-
PDLC appeared first. As the most mature and lowest cost technology, the majority of Chinese dimming glass manufacturers use the solution;
-
SPD is mainly used in high-end models such as Mercedes S/SL and yachts due to high power consumption and high cost;
-
Dye LC spends a relatively short time dimming with dichroic dye molecules;
-
EC has low haze, low energy consumption, good thermal insulation effect, continuous dimming, relatively long dimming time (2min on average) and medium cost.
Currently, smart dimming glass is often used in panoramic canopies, not only to give a deeper spatial impression but also automatically reduce the transmittance of ultraviolet and infrared rays of the burning sun for the purpose of lowering the temperature inside. According to data from the publisher, 1,636,900 units of new passenger cars in China installed with panoramic canopies in 2022, 0.5% of which are smart dimming canopies. It is expected that panoramic canopies will be installed in 3,684,100 units of new passenger cars by 2025, 6.1% of which are smart dimming canopies.
In this report, the panoramic canopy refers to: not opening the large-sized sunroof without segmental structure; the dimming canopy means: enabling the smart dimming control function based on the panoramic canopy.
In the future, smart dimming glass can be used on side windows and front windshields and more. For example, the side windows can display advertisements (display when the car is stopped and become transparent when the car starts and accelerates), and offer the backseat graffiti function for children, human-computer interaction, entertainment and more capabilities; the front windshield includes an AR HUD for anti-glare: combined with the front view camera, it detects the high beam of the oncoming vehicle, and automatically adjusts the transmittance of the front windshield to eliminate glare and ensure safe driving. driving.
At CES 2023, the BMW iVISION Dee Concept car featuring Gauzy’s PDLC and SPD glass technologies was shown. The front windshield enables the HUD to provide a wide viewing angle for a virtual image for all passengers; the side window supports dynamic privacy, shading, and ambiance management.
The split SPD-LCG smart glass windshield for BMW iVISION Dee allows the HUD to provide wide viewing angles for a virtual image.
From the smart dimming glass industry chain, it can be seen that the upstream mainly produces related dimming materials, films, glass substrates and PVBs; the midstream is responsible for the integration of dimming glass applied to OEM markets and aftermarkets. Upstream and midstream manufacturers are the first to start deploying patents. Among the global top 1,000 companies by patent filings, the first five companies are BOE, Nitto DenkoRicoh, Sony and Fuyao, where most of the BOE and Fuyao patents are filed during 2019-2022.
For example, in May 2019 The BOE filed CN 210514886 U Dimming Glass Patent, a display window technology patent in which the dimming glass layer is positioned with a basic dimming structure and a functional dimming structure: the first is used to adjust the light transmittance that shining on it, and the latter. used to reflect the light of a specific waveband that shines on it.
From the prospective smart dimming glass supply, the main suppliers are Fuyao, AGC, NSG, Gauzy, Saint-Gobain, Ambilight, and Research Frontiers. Among them, Fuyao remains completely dominant, thanks to strong supply relationships in the automotive glass market, as well as factors such as dimming glass technology R&D, cost balancing and occupant experience.
In the OEM market, installed models include Toyota Venza, BYD Seal, Neta S, Lotus Eletre, NIO EC7, Porsche Taycan, Lexus RZ, and Cadillac CELESTIQ (not mass-produced). Among them, the burning canopy glass surface of the Porsche Taycan is divided into nine individually controlled areas, and offers five dimming effects: transparent, matte, translucent, vivid, and user-defined. In the future, as consumers demand more beautiful, more comfortable and more intelligent cars, smart dimming glass will lead to a boom period in other fields in addition to the panoramic canopy.
